-neoscrypt 7% faster on the 750ti and 4% faster on the gtx 970 -fixed crash in neoscrypt -Stop mining when disconnecting (fixed by pallas) -tiny speedup quark 1.5.57(sp-MOD) is available here: (25-07-2015) https://github.com/sp-hash/ccminer/releases/The sourcecode is available here: https://github.com/sp-hash/ccminer

Submitted an optimalization in neoscrypt.
7% faster on the 750ti (+11KHASH) 4% faster on the 970 (+20KHASH)
Is there any tutarial to create a miner with latest commit? I knew that i need cuda,visial basic and cc miner .I downloaded all but i don2t know how to do ![Smiley](https://bitcointalk.org/Smileys/default/smiley.gif) )) 1. Download and install visualstudio 2013 express (free) 2. install cuda 6.5 3. download the sourcecode from git. 4. Open the project file (.sln) 5. Select release in the combobox on the top. 6. Press play
